How Long Can Labor Last For Cats. The birth is usually complete within six hours after the start of the second stage, but can last up to 12. However, it is not unusual for some cats to carry a normal litter for either a shorter or longer time (range 58 to 70 days). Signs my cat is going into labor. Time between delivery of kittens is usually 10 to 60 minutes and stages two and three are repeated. In some cases, it can last up to 24 hours!
